(C) Copyright 1999, 2000, 2001, 2002, 2003, 2004 Axis Communications AB, LUND, SWEDEN*!*! $Id: ds1302.c,v 1.18 2005/01/24 09:11:26 mikaelam Exp $*!*!***************************************************************************/#include <linux/config.h>#include <linux/fs.h>#include <linux/init.h>#include <linux/mm.h>#include <linux/module.h>#include <linux/miscdevice.h>#include <linux/delay.h>#include <linux/bcd.h>#include <linux/capability.h>#include <asm/uaccess.h>#include <asm/system.h>#include <asm/arch/svinto.h>#include <asm/io.h>#include <asm/rtc.h>#include <asm/arch/io_interface_mux.h>#define RTC_MAJOR_NR 121 /* local major, change later */static const char ds1302_name[] = "ds1302";/* The DS1302 might be connected to different bits on different products. * It has three signals - SDA, SCL and RST. RST and SCL are always outputs, * but SDA can have a selected direction. * For now, only PORT_PB is hardcoded. *//* The RST bit may be on either the Generic Port or Port PB. */#ifdef CONFIG_ETRAX_DS1302_RST_ON_GENERIC_PORT#define TK_RST_OUT(x) REG_SHADOW_SET(R_PORT_G_DATA, port_g_data_shadow, CONFIG_ETRAX_DS1302_RSTBIT, x)#define TK_RST_DIR(x)#else#define TK_RST_OUT(x) REG_SHADOW_SET(R_PORT_PB_DATA, port_pb_data_shadow, CONFIG_ETRAX_DS1302_RSTBIT, x)#define TK_RST_DIR(x) REG_SHADOW_SET(R_PORT_PB_DIR, port_pb_dir_shadow, CONFIG_ETRAX_DS1302_RSTBIT, x)#endif#define TK_SDA_OUT(x) REG_SHADOW_SET(R_PORT_PB_DATA, port_pb_data_shadow, CONFIG_ETRAX_DS1302_SDABIT, x)#define TK_SCL_OUT(x) REG_SHADOW_SET(R_PORT_PB_DATA, port_pb_data_shadow, CONFIG_ETRAX_DS1302_SCLBIT, x)#define TK_SDA_IN() ((*R_PORT_PB_READ >> CONFIG_ETRAX_DS1302_SDABIT) & 1)/* 1 is out, 0 is in */#define TK_SDA_DIR(x) REG_SHADOW_SET(R_PORT_PB_DIR, port_pb_dir_shadow, CONFIG_ETRAX_DS1302_SDABIT, x)#define TK_SCL_DIR(x) REG_SHADOW_SET(R_PORT_PB_DIR, port_pb_dir_shadow, CONFIG_ETRAX_DS1302_SCLBIT, x)/* * The reason for tempudelay and not udelay is that loops_per_usec * (used in udelay) is not set when functions here are called from time.c */static void tempudelay(int usecs) { volatile int loops; for(loops = usecs * 12; loops > 0; loops--) /* nothing */; }/* Send 8 bits. */static voidout_byte(unsigned char x) { int i; TK_SDA_DIR(1); for (i = 8; i--;) { /* The chip latches incoming bits on the rising edge of SCL. */ TK_SCL_OUT(0); TK_SDA_OUT(x & 1); tempudelay(1); TK_SCL_OUT(1); tempudelay(1); x >>= 1; } TK_SDA_DIR(0);}static unsigned charin_byte(void) { unsigned char x = 0; int i; /* Read byte. Bits come LSB first, on the falling edge of SCL. * Assume SDA is in input direction already. */ TK_SDA_DIR(0); for (i = 8; i--;) { TK_SCL_OUT(0); tempudelay(1); x >>= 1; x |= (TK_SDA_IN() << 7); TK_SCL_OUT(1); tempudelay(1); } return x;}/* Prepares for a transaction by de-activating RST (active-low). */static voidstart(void) { TK_SCL_OUT(0); tempudelay(1); TK_RST_OUT(0); tempudelay(5); TK_RST_OUT(1); }/* Ends a transaction by taking RST active again. */static voidstop(void) { tempudelay(2); TK_RST_OUT(0);}/* Enable writing. */static voidds1302_wenable(void) { start(); out_byte(0x8e); /* Write control register */ out_byte(0x00); /* Disable write protect bit 7 = 0 */ stop();}/* Disable writing. */static voidds1302_wdisable(void) { start(); out_byte(0x8e); /* Write control register */ out_byte(0x80); /* Disable write protect bit 7 = 0 */ stop();}/* Read a byte from the selected register in the DS1302. */unsigned chards1302_readreg(int reg) { unsigned char x; start(); out_byte(0x81 | (reg << 1)); /* read register */ x = in_byte(); stop(); return x;}/* Write a byte to the selected register. */voidds1302_writereg(int reg, unsigned char val) {#ifndef CONFIG_ETRAX_RTC_READONLY int do_writereg = 1;#else int do_writereg = 0; if (reg == RTC_TRICKLECHARGER) do_writereg = 1;#endif
